Stop At: Andrew Jackson's Hermitage, 4580 Rachels Ln, Nashville, Tennessee 37076
Located only minutes from downtown and Gaylord Opryland resort, this is a must-do when visiting Music City.
This 1,120-acre National Historic Landmark features over 10 historic buildings, a seasonal wagon tour, walking trails, beautiful gardens and grounds, and much, much more. The Hermitage mansion is considered to be the most accurately preserved early presidential home in the country.
In recent years, new interpretive initiatives and programs have enhanced the experience of some 225,000 annual visitors. The Hermitage is Tennessee’s top-rated historic home.

Stop At: Belle Meade Historic Site & Winery, 110 Leake Ave, Nashville, Tennessee 37205
While at Belle Meade a costumed guide will take you on a 45-minute tour of the Harding’s Greek Revival style mansion built in 1853.
The guide will share stories of the people who lived there, the horses they raised, and the people that worked on the Thoroughbred farm.
At the end of the tour there is a complimentary wine tasting in our on-site winery. While here, enjoy a self-guided tour of our 8 historic out-buildings and 30-acre grounds.

Stop At: Historic Travellers Rest, 636 Farrell Pkwy, Nashville, Tennessee 37220
The plantation and museum covers 1,000 years of history ranging from its origins as a Native American settlement through the Civil War and Nashville’s emergence as a leading capitol of the New South.
The Overton home serves as a gateway for learners of all ages to explore and experience Nashville’s historic past.

Stop At: Musicians Hall of Fame and Museum, 401 Gay St, Nashville, Tennessee 37201
Our main focus is session musicians and the tour really explores the stories behind the recording sessions from countless hit records. It is full of rich music history that spans over many popular recording cities in the United States.
We also have the GRAMMY Museum Gallery which includes tons of interactive exhibits. Guests can play on instruments, experience what the recording process is like, and sing a little bit of karaoke. It is great fun for all ages.
